WebMar 29, 2015 · The fear of clocks is characterized by a fear of time passing by too quickly. Chronomentrophobia may comprise of anxiety related to punctuality, schedules or other realistic apprehensions. Certain occupations can aggravate this phobia. People who face strict deadlines or punch clocks have an amplified hatred or fear about clocks. WebClocks with Roman numerals. For as long as I’ve remembered I’ve been jolted awake by my alarm clock; I think it started … WebKampanaphobia (from Greek kampana, meaning bell) is the fear of bells. This phobia is commonly triggered by a negative experience with bells, such as getting scared when a bell rings, or getting injured when a person that reacts to bell bumps or knock them over. Symptoms of kampanaphobia include panic, dread, feeling of doom, heart palpations, …
